I've 2010 i30 Crdi and once or twice a year the remote won't unlock the car and it always in my driveway. Then i have to unlock it with the key and of course the alarm goes off and being a bus driver it's very early in the morning, any ideas?

 :welcumwagon: Could there be any electronic transmitters near your house? Radio station, Telephone tower, etc.. these can interfere with the remote signal.

I had this exact problem with my FD. Always in my driveway.

Dealer went out of their way and even replaced the Body Control module. Unfortunately didn't fix it. Eventually after more testing I noticed if I drove my car 200m down the street it went away then back to my driveway it recurred.

The problem has gone away now. I do live about 200m from a mobile phone tower in the opposite direction. In retrospect it may have been around the time when 4G was being tested or switched on.

As has been said, it will be interference from somewhere, I had the same problem outside a restaurant and when one of the waiters saw me struggling he rushed out and said it was their WIFI and many peeps had had the same problem parked in that space.
